Description

Once we get rid of the slow processor, we should be able to refactor our basic block nodes to look something like this:
```rust
pub struct BasicBlockNode {
/// operations here would contain Respan operations to mark boundaries of operation batches
ops: Vec,
digest: Word,
}
```
This structure has a number of benefits:

- The fast processor would need just a single loop to iterate over all operations in a basic block.
- We would allocate only a single vector per basic block vs. allocating a vector (plus several arrays) per operation batch.
- Fast (but trusted) serialization/deserialization of the basic block becomes trivial.

I would create a couple of complications though:
- Computing the hash of the node would be a bit more complicated, and this would make the slow (but untrusted) deserialization more difficult.
- Trace generation would require more work because trace builders would need to build the `OpBatch` structs themselves.

Both of these are acceptable tradeoffs in my opinion.
